picrotoxin

noun
pic·​ro·​tox·​in | \ ˌpi-krō-ˈtäk-sən How to pronounce picrotoxin (audio) \

Definition of picrotoxin

: a poisonous bitter crystalline stimulant and convulsive substance C30H34O13 obtained from the berry of a southeast Asian vine (Anamirta cocculus) and used intravenously as an antidote for barbiturate poisoning

First Known Use of picrotoxin

1815, in the meaning defined above

Medical Definition of picrotoxin

: a poisonous bitter crystalline principle C30H34O13 found especially in cocculus that is a compound of picrotoxinin and picrotin and is a stimulant and convulsant drug administered intravenously as an antidote for poisoning by overdoses of barbiturates
